Innovative Fitness Kitsilano took full advantage of the May long weekend to explore the unknown waters of Tofino. We brought together a group of 5 coaches and 13 IF members for a weekend of surfing & yoga. With our fingers crossed for sunshine, we gathered at the facility Friday afternoon and set off for our adventure. Though we had not all met before, the ferry and long windy drive provided ample time for meet and greet as we distanced ourselves from the city. We arrived just in time for a foggy sunset at Ocean Beach Village Resort and with its rustic A-frame cabins nestled right on Mackenzie Beach, it was the perfect home base for the activities that lie ahead.

Early Saturday morning, the coaches united to prepare a group pre-surf breakfast. It was surprisingly easy to transport and organize surf equipment, rentals and lesson plans for 18 people. People were cooperative and quick at signing their wavers. Long Beach Surf Shop gave us a great deal on wet suits, gloves, boots, boards and even helped us stack boards on our vehicles. Surf Sister led the way to Cox Bay for our two hour surf lesson. Although the skies were gloomy at the start, we were thankful it was not raining as it usually does this time of year in Tofino. Within an hour of “surfees” (think burpees on a surf board) and ocean safety talks, our spirits were lifted even higher when the sun decided to poke its way through the clouds just as we entered the water. Lucky for us the sun did not disappear all weekend!

Given the conditions when we left that morning, no one was prepared for a day at the beach, but once the lesson was over we made the most of the sunny day. Snacks, blankets, coolers and speakers were retrieved from cars and within 30 minutes we were back, leaning against a piece of driftwood on the beach while some tried their hand at yoga, did a beach workout, or played Frisbee.

Fast forward to Saturday evening, our bellies filled with Tacofino’s famous fish tacos; it was time for a yoga class. Coastal Bliss Yoga guided us through a sweaty, challenging yoga flow class. When the group returned from their hour of Zen there was BBQ chicken and salads awaiting them at a communal table. After a delicious family style meal we headed in to town to see a local band at the community centre and hang with more IF friends on School Bus turned RV.

We kept our equipment over the weekend so early Sunday we set off for our second day of surfing. The waves were still great for all levels, if you stayed shallow you could easily catch some baby waves in the white wash and if you were feeling confident the water was calm enough to paddle out and wait for an unbroken wave. Everybody gave surfing their best shot, which is all you can ask. Some fell in love right away while others came to realize they preferred to waddle through water without the board. Whichever strategy, stepping outside our comfort zone to experience new things was the goal and everyone accomplished this by day two.

The evening consisted of a second yoga session only this time a much gentler, yin style class. For those lucky enough to sneak out for one last sunset surf, we came home to a delicious Halibut Puttanesca feast just as it was getting dark. With full bellies we found ourselves huddled around a beach fire where we shared stories, listened to music, and ate the best s’mores ever; homemade marshmallows, burnt caramel chocolate sauce and graham crackers. YUM.

Monday came too quickly. We left Tofino earlier than expected as we had been invited to a pit-stop feast at the West’s family cabin on Sproat Lake on route to the Nanaimo Ferry. Ben, Margot, and the kids generously fed our group with BBQ Brisket and Pulled Pork tacos. We swam away the salt water in a fresh water lake then continued on our way back to the city. Although the group was far quieter on the way home, we knew it was out of pleasure and satisfaction. It is always hard to leave paradise, especially when it is as mystical and natural as Tofino.
